How to Transfer Funds Using Uco Bank Babaicha IFSC Code?

You can transfer money electronically to the Uco Bank Babaicha branch using the IFSC code UCBA0001182. Follow this step-by-step transaction guide:

  1. Log in to your bank's official internet banking portal or open their mobile banking application.
  2. Navigate to the **'Fund Transfer'** or **'Add Beneficiary'** option.
  3. Enter the beneficiary's name and their account number.
  4. In the IFSC field, enter the 11-digit code UCBA0001182.
  5. The system will automatically verify the branch name as **Babaicha** located at Vpo Babaicha, Dist Ajmer. ,ajmer ,rajasthan Pin 305811.
  6. Confirm the beneficiary registration and choose your transfer method: **NEFT**, **RTGS**, or **IMPS**.
  7. Enter the amount you wish to transfer and complete the transaction securely via OTP verification.

Important: Always double check the account number and IFSC code before authorizing a transaction to avoid failures or incorrect deposits.
